A Walmart employee grabbed the store's loudspeaker system and delivered a searing, unfiltered resignation speech to the entire store. She called out toxic management, sexual harassment, and poor working conditions by name before walking out the front doors. The Social Media Discussion

Before we dive into the top 10 scandals, it's essential to understand what an MMS scandal is. MMS (Multimedia Messaging Service) refers to a type of messaging service that allows users to send multimedia content such as images, videos, and audio files. An MMS scandal typically involves the unauthorized sharing of intimate or compromising videos or images of individuals, often leading to embarrassment, shame, and even severe consequences for those involved.
